CodeMyUI features and specs

  • High-Quality Demos
    CodeMyUI provides a wide range of high-quality UI/UX design resources and code snippets, which are highly polished and visually appealing.
  • Variety of Components
    The site offers a diverse array of components ranging from buttons, loaders, and navigations to complete page layouts, making it a one-stop resource for developers and designers.
  • Ease of Use
    The website is user-friendly and well-categorized, helping users to quickly find and implement the desired UI components and design inspirations.
  • Regular Updates
    New content is added regularly, ensuring that developers have access to the latest trends and innovative design ideas in UI/UX.
  • Free Resources
    Many of the code snippets and design resources on CodeMyUI are available for free, providing valuable tools for developers without additional cost.

Possible disadvantages of CodeMyUI

  • Limited Interactivity
    While CodeMyUI offers a plethora of static and animated UI components, it lacks interactive elements that require more complex user interactions.
  • Attribution Requirement
    Some of the free resources may require attribution, which could be a limitation for commercial projects that prefer to not include credits.
  • Inconsistency in Code Quality
    Since different contributors add code snippets, there might be inconsistencies in code quality or outdated techniques that users need to watch out for.
  • No Advanced Tutorials
    The website does not provide in-depth tutorials or explanatory content that shows how to integrate these snippets into larger projects, which can be a drawback for beginners.
  • Advertisement Presence
    The website contains advertisements, which might be distracting for users and can affect the overall browsing experience.

Gardenate features and specs

  • User-Friendly Interface
    Gardenate provides an intuitive and easy-to-use interface that helps users, regardless of their gardening experience level, to navigate through the site effectively.
  • Comprehensive Planting Guide
    The platform offers detailed planting guides, which include information on when and how to plant a wide variety of herbs, vegetables, and fruits, making it a valuable resource for gardeners.
  • Customized Planting Calendar
    Gardenate allows users to customize planting calendars based on their specific location, ensuring that the planting information is relevant to their climate and growing conditions.
  • Mobile App Availability
    Gardenate offers a mobile app that makes it convenient for users to access gardening information on the go, helping them manage their gardens more efficiently.

Possible disadvantages of Gardenate

  • Limited Regional Information
    While Gardenate provides regional planting information, it may not cover all areas or specific microclimates, which could affect the accuracy of the planting advice for some users.
  • In-App Purchases
    Some features of the Gardenate app may require in-app purchases, which could be a drawback for users looking for a completely free resource.
  • Basic Community Features
    The platform lacks more advanced community features, such as forums or social networking options, which might limit user interaction and the sharing of personalized gardening tips.
  • Occasional Lack of Detailed Plant Information
    While Gardenate covers a wide range of plants, some users might find the information provided to be less detailed compared to other specialized gardening resources.
